Cryogenic Nbung hpe garan ginhka ai hpaji ngu ai gaw hpa rai ta?

 

Cryogenic nbung garan ginhka ai hpaji masa gaw, nbung n-gun rawng ai nbung ni a hka n-gun n bung ai hpe madung tawn nna, shawng nnan nbung hpe grai n-gun n law ai (gas n-gun langai hpra a hka n-gun hta grau n-gun n law ai), law malawng gaw -180℃npu de du hkra katsi shangun nna, nbung n-gun n bung ai hpe lang nna, nbung ni hpe distill galaw nna garan ginhka ai.

 

Cryogenic nbung hpe garan ginhka ai hpaji hpe n-gang, tsi hpaji, electronics, tsi hpaji, nbungli hpaji hte kaga hpaji ni hta grai jai lang nga ai. Dai gaw, hpaga lam hta lang ai nbung hpe garan ginhka ai hta madung ladat rai nna, ya aten hta oxygen, nitrogen, argon hte n law htum nbung ni hpe hpaga lam hta galaw shapraw na matu kungkyang dik ai hte akyu rawng dik ai ladat rai nga ai.

Cryogenic nbung hpe garan ginhka ai ladat

 

Cryogenic distillation nbung hpe garan ginhka ai lam hta lawu na lahkam kru hpe hkan sa ra ai.

 

Nbung hpe n-gun shayawm ai: Nbung hpe n-gun shayawm ai (compressor) ni a lahkam law law hte n-gun shayawm ai, nbung hpe katsi hkra galaw na matu hte dai hpang garan ginhka lu na matu ra ai n-gun hpe jaw ya ai. Dai n-gun atsam gaw 0.5Mpa~0.8Mpa (n-gun rawng ai jak), shing nrai 3Mpa~6Mpa (n-gun kaba ai jak) rai mai ai.

 

Pre-cooling: Nbung a n-gun hpe hka lim ai shara de nbung katsi ai jak (galaw madang hku nna katsi ai hka (sh) katsi ai hka) hte shayawm kau ai, 5℃kaw nna 10℃daram , hpang na cryogenic nbung garan ginhka ai lam hta ra ai n-gun hpe shayawm ya ai.

 

Pre-san seng ai lam: Hka lum, carbon dioxide hte hydrocarbons zawn re ai awu asin ni hpe shapraw kau na matu, n-gun n law ai shara hta katsi mat ai hte jak ni hpe pat shingdang ai lam ni hpe pat shingdang lu ai, cryogenic galaw ai lam hpe shim lum hkra galaw lu ai.

 

Deep cooling: San seng ai nbung gaw katsi ai nbung lwi ai hte katsi ai hpe galai shai nna, kalang lang katsi mat wa nna, -170℃kaw nna -180℃daram du hkra, nbung kata na nbung nkau mi gaw hka zawn byin mat ai.

 

Distillation garan ginhka ai lam: N-gun kaba ai column gaw oxygen-law ai ntsin hte nitrogen-law ai ntsin hpe garan ginhka ai. Bai hka ja ngut ai hpang, n-gun n law ai column kaw na, n-gun ja ai-san seng ai oxygen hte nitrogen hpe lu la ai. Bai nna, argon gas hpe n-gun n law ai column a lapran kaw nna woi pru wa ai.

 

Gas extraction and storage: Oxygen, nitrogen and argon are reheated to gas and and then output. Some are liquefied for storage, such as liquid oxygen and liquid nitrogen. However, high purity oxygen (>99.5%), nitrogen (>99.9%), and argon (>99.9%) hpe hpyi shawn ai hte maren lu la mai ai.

 

Cryogenic Nbung hpe garan ginhka na matu Molecular Sieves ni

 

13X APG zeolite n-gun n-gun n-gun: Nbung cryogenic nbung garan ginhka ai bungli a matu laksan galaw da ai rai nna, gara nbung cryo-garan ginhka ai jak ni hta mung jai lang mai ai. 13X APG gaw hka hte carbon dioxide hpe n-gun ja ai lata la ai atsam nga ai.

 

13X HP Zeolite n-gun n-gun n-gun: Oxygen hte nitrogen hpe garan ginhka ai atsam grai law ai hte oxygen hpe law law shapraw lu ai atsam nga ai, dai hpe law malawng gaw oxygen hte nitrogen hpe garan ginhka ai lam hpe galaw sa wa na matu oxygen shapraw ai unit ni a matu jai lang ai, dai gaw hpaga lam hte tsi tsi ai lam hta oxygen hpe n-gun ja shangun ai.

 

13X APG III Zeolite n-gun rawng ai hka htung: 13X APG a rawt jat galu kaba wa ai amyu langai mi re. Zeolite 13X APG III a hka hpe hkap la lu ai atsam gaw 13X APG hta 60%~70% grau law ai. Carbon dioxide n law ai shara hta pyi, 13X APG III a hka hpe hkap la lu ai atsam gaw kaja wa naw galaw nga ai.

 

13X APG V Zeolite n-gun n-gun n-gun n-gun: 13X APG V a adsorption atsam gaw 13X APG hta lahkawng lang jan law ai, 13X APG III. 13X APG V a molecular sieve hta na htam 1.4 jan gaw cryogenic nbung garan ginhka ai bungli hta ningbaw ningla langai rai nna, shi a atsam masat kumla ni gaw shi a shawng na ni hta grau kaja ai.
